数据库表1(学号,语文成绩,数学成绩,英语成绩),表2(学号,总成绩).怎么能让我们只输入
来源:学生作业帮 编辑:神马作文网作业帮 分类:综合作业 时间:2024/10/02 06:36:21
数据库表1(学号,语文成绩,数学成绩,英语成绩),表2(学号,总成绩).怎么能让我们只输入
表1中3个成绩,表2就会自动生成总成绩
表1中3个成绩,表2就会自动生成总成绩
1、一般来说在数据库中表2不用做,直接用表1生成个视图即可,select 学号,语文成绩+数学成绩+英语成绩 as 总成绩 from 数据库表1
2、如果真的想设计2张表,而且实时更新,就要写触发器,包括insert和update和delete的都要写
3、如果不是要求实时更新,在更新表1后,用表1的值的合计去更新表2的值,update 表2 set 表2.总成绩=表1.语文成绩+数学成绩+英语成绩 where 表1.学号=表2.学号
不同的数据库支持的sql预计稍微有点不同,具体的查询手册
2、如果真的想设计2张表,而且实时更新,就要写触发器,包括insert和update和delete的都要写
3、如果不是要求实时更新,在更新表1后,用表1的值的合计去更新表2的值,update 表2 set 表2.总成绩=表1.语文成绩+数学成绩+英语成绩 where 表1.学号=表2.学号
不同的数据库支持的sql预计稍微有点不同,具体的查询手册
输入8个同学学号和语文、数学、英语成绩,按总分从低到高输出学号和语文、数学、英语成绩.调试数据 5301,88,90,9
输入两个学生的姓名学号英语数学成绩,输出这两个学生的姓名学号平均分
2.完成下面父类及子类的声明 (1) 声明Student类属性包括学号、姓名、英语成绩、数学成绩、计算机成绩和总
C语言编程题:任意输入五个同学的成绩(设为整数)及学号,找出他们的最高分同学的学号及成绩.
用C++编写.设某班有3门课程(语文,数学,英语)的成绩.先输入学生人数,然后按学号(设为3位)从小到大的顺序依次输入学
从键盘输入某班级10个学生的学号、姓名、三门课程(语文、数学、英语)的成绩,分别实现如下功能:
一个人数学成绩与学号有没有依赖关系(初二函数)
小女子感激不尽!《高等数学》(上)试题班级 学号 姓名 一 二 三 四 五 总成绩一、(函数)你能体会到指数增长是怎样的
用C++写的学生成绩管理系统,要求输入一个班级的学生基本信息(包括学号,姓名,性别,5门课程成绩).2、
SQL语句查询每个学生的学号、姓名、平均成绩、最高成绩和最低成绩
怎么提高数学成绩和语文成绩?
一个班10个同学,每个学生有学号,以及数学、物理、英语、语文、体育5门课的成绩信息.分别编写3个函数以